What is Mucoid Degeneration of ACL?
Mucoid degeneration is a condition where gel-like mucin material accumulates within the ACL fibers, causing thickening and reduced function of the ligament.Unlike an ACL tear, the ligament remains intact but becomes degenerative and stiff, leading to chronic knee pain and restricted movement.
Global & Indian Data on Mucoid Degeneration
Mucoid degeneration was once considered extremely rare, but recent studies suggest otherwise:
• Global MRI-based studies show a prevalence of 1.8% to 5.3% in patients undergoing knee scans
• Some advanced imaging studies report even higher detection rates, up to 9.2% in knee MRI cases
• It is more common in middle-aged individuals (40–60 years)
• Frequently associated with osteoarthritis and degenerative knee conditions

Better MRI Technology
Earlier, this condition was rarely diagnosed. Now:
• High-resolution MRI detects subtle changes
• “Celery stalk appearance” is a key identifying feature
Trend: More diagnosis ≠ more disease, but better detection

Latest Treatment Trends in Mucoid Degeneration
Treatment has evolved significantly over the past decade.
1. Conservative Management (First-Line Approach)
Modern approach focuses on non-surgical care initially:
• Physiotherapy
• Strength training
• Activity modification
• Pain management
Trend: Avoid unnecessary surgery unless required
Arthroscopic Minimally Invasive Surgery
If symptoms persist, arthroscopic debridement is preferred:
• Removal of degenerated tissue
• Preservation of healthy ligament
• Faster recovery

Symptoms to Watch (Important for Early Diagnosis)
• Persistent knee pain
• Pain during bending or squatting
• Stiffness in knee joint
• Difficulty climbing stairs
• Reduced flexibility
